Žigon (pronounced [ˈʒiːɡɔn]) is a village in the Municipality of Laško in eastern Slovenia. It lies in the hills to the southeast of Laško. The area was traditionally part of the Styria region. It is now included with the rest of the municipality in the Savinja Statistical Region.[2]

A small roadside chapel-shrine in the settlement dates to the 19th century.[3]
